About Us
The Patient-Centered Outcomes Research Institute (PCORI) is an independent nonprofit organization authorized by Congress in 2010. Its mission is to fund research that will provide patients, their caregivers and clinicians with the evidence-based information needed to make better-informed healthcare decisions. PCORI is committed to continually seeking input from a broad range of stakeholders to guide its work.
Position Summary
The intern will participate in a project to better understand how patient peer reviews are used by editors and authors of final research reports. The project will involve developing a coding scheme to identify the most useful and least useful comments in patient peer reviews and compare those with whether the peer review associate editors highlight any patient reviewer comments and whether report authors respond, with changes, to the patient reviewer comments. The project is part of an ongoing program to improve the usefulness of patient peer reviews and potentially encourage the use of patient peer reviewers in journal reviews.
